Under-five mortality rate in Ireland, 1949–2024
Source: World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ory.
Analysis
Ireland recorded 3.86 for under-five mortality rate in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.6% on the previous year and up 2.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, under-five mortality rate in Ireland peaked at 56.36 in 1949 and was at its lowest, 3.43, in 2018.
That places Ireland 171st out of 200 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Under-five mortality rate in Ireland,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1949 | 56.36 | — |
| 1950 | 54.2 | -3.8% |
| 1951 | 51.96 | -4.1% |
| 1952 | 49.55 | -4.6% |
| 1953 | 47.15 | -4.8% |
| 1954 | 44.91 | -4.8% |
| 1955 | 42.92 | -4.4% |
| 1956 | 41.21 | -4.0% |
| 1957 | 39.75 | -3.5% |
| 1958 | 38.33 | -3.6% |
| 1959 | 36.82 | -4.0% |
| 1960 | 35.25 | -4.3% |
| 1961 | 33.81 | -4.1% |
| 1962 | 32.53 | -3.8% |
| 1963 | 31.33 | -3.7% |
| 1964 | 30.06 | -4.1% |
| 1965 | 28.67 | -4.6% |
| 1966 | 27.13 | -5.4% |
| 1967 | 25.51 | -6.0% |
| 1968 | 24.06 | -5.7% |
| 1969 | 22.96 | -4.6% |
| 1970 | 22.21 | -3.3% |
| 1971 | 21.74 | -2.1% |
| 1972 | 21.41 | -1.5% |
| 1973 | 21.09 | -1.5% |
| 1974 | 20.62 | -2.2% |
| 1975 | 19.95 | -3.2% |
| 1976 | 19.09 | -4.3% |
| 1977 | 18.05 | -5.4% |
| 1978 | 16.86 | -6.6% |
| 1979 | 15.55 | -7.7% |
| 1980 | 14.27 | -8.2% |
| 1981 | 13.19 | -7.6% |
| 1982 | 12.35 | -6.3% |
| 1983 | 11.7 | -5.3% |
| 1984 | 11.15 | -4.7% |
| 1985 | 10.71 | -3.9% |
| 1986 | 10.39 | -3.0% |
| 1987 | 10.17 | -2.2% |
| 1988 | 9.93 | -2.3% |
| 1989 | 9.61 | -3.3% |
| 1990 | 9.18 | -4.5% |
| 1991 | 8.65 | -5.7% |
| 1992 | 8.11 | -6.3% |
| 1993 | 7.66 | -5.6% |
| 1994 | 7.39 | -3.5% |
| 1995 | 7.29 | -1.4% |
| 1996 | 7.28 | -0.1% |
| 1997 | 7.31 | +0.4% |
| 1998 | 7.34 | +0.3% |
| 1999 | 7.3 | -0.5% |
| 2000 | 7.17 | -1.8% |
| 2001 | 6.9 | -3.7% |
| 2002 | 6.51 | -5.7% |
| 2003 | 6.05 | -7.0% |
| 2004 | 5.59 | -7.6% |
| 2005 | 5.18 | -7.4% |
| 2006 | 4.85 | -6.4% |
| 2007 | 4.61 | -4.9% |
| 2008 | 4.43 | -3.8% |
| 2009 | 4.29 | -3.2% |
| 2010 | 4.17 | -2.9% |
| 2011 | 4.06 | -2.5% |
| 2012 | 3.97 | -2.3% |
| 2013 | 3.87 | -2.4% |
| 2014 | 3.77 | -2.6% |
| 2015 | 3.66 | -2.7% |
| 2016 | 3.56 | -2.8% |
| 2017 | 3.48 | -2.4% |
| 2018 | 3.43 | -1.4% |
| 2019 | 3.43 | +0.2% |
| 2020 | 3.49 | +1.6% |
| 2021 | 3.58 | +2.7% |
| 2022 | 3.7 | +3.2% |
| 2023 | 3.8 | +2.8% |
| 2024 | 3.86 | +1.6% |
